Ricky Gervais Christchurch Tour Overview
The Christchurch performance was part of Gervais’s critically acclaimed Armageddon tour, a series of shows that explore themes like death, politics, social media, and fame, all through his uniquely cynical and deeply funny lens. The Ricky Gervais Christchurch event was held at Christchurch Arena, drawing in thousands of fans who had waited months, if not years, to see him perform live. The venue, known for hosting high-profile international acts, was an ideal setting for an evening of provocative humor and brilliant storytelling.
The tour’s name, Armageddon, is both ironic and fitting. Gervais uses it to dive into serious topics while making people laugh, often pushing the audience to reflect on the absurdities of modern life. From artificial intelligence to the afterlife, nothing was off the table during the Christchurch set.

Where is Ricky Gervais’s After Life set?
The hit Netflix series After Life, created and starring Ricky Gervais, is set in the fictional town of Tambury. Filming primarily took place in Hemel Hempstead, a town in Hertfordshire, England. The scenic British town adds to the show’s charm and melancholy atmosphere.
